Storage Server

存储服务器是分布式文件系统中的核心组件,主要负责文件和文件属性的持久化存储。

Group 的优势与局限性

优势

  1. 应用隔离性:不同应用的数据存储在完全独立的 Group 中
  2. 灵活的负载均衡
  3. 副本策略定制化

局限性

  1. 存储容量受限于组内服务器节点容量
  2. 数据恢复依赖组内节点

存储目录配置

storage.data_dirs = /data/disk1,/data/disk2

Tracker Server

Tracker Server 是 FastDFS 的核心调度组件,负责集群的负载均衡和资源调度。

核心功能

  1. 负载均衡:基于存储节点的磁盘剩余空间选择目标 Storage
  2. 服务发现:维护 Storage 节点的心跳检测
  3. 协议支持:使用自定义二进制协议,默认监听端口为 22122